The Kingham Plough is set in a beautiful 350 year old building opposite the village green in the quintessentially English village of Kingham, once voted England's favourite village by Country Life Magazine. The bar area with beams, exposed brickwork and open log fire leads into the much acclaimed restaurant, the first venture of chef proprietor Emily Watkins, who was former sous chef at Heston Blumenthal's Fat Duck.
Emily is a very keen advocate of local produce and there are daily deliveries from local fruit farms, small holdings and game estates, as well as foraged funghi and sea vegetables for her innovative modern British cuisine.
